The OpenNET Project / Index page

[ новости /+++ | форум | теги | ]

форумы  помощь  поиск  регистрация  майллист  вход/выход  слежка  RSS
"кеширующий nginx + внутренний nginx+fast-cgi проблема с IE7 "
Вариант для распечатки  
Пред. тема | След. тема 
Форумы WEB технологии (Public)
Изначальное сообщение [ Отслеживать ]

"кеширующий nginx + внутренний nginx+fast-cgi проблема с IE7 "  
Сообщение от Drock email(ok) on 10-Окт-08, 08:43 
Значит стоит у меня проксирующий реверси сервер на входе

конфига следующая реверси следующая

server {
                listen       80;
                server_name shop.sunrise-ufa.ru;

                access_log  /var/log/nginx/host.access.log  main;

                # Main location
                location / {  
                    proxy_pass         http://10.10.255.6:80/;
                    proxy_redirect     on;                    

                    proxy_set_header   Host             $host;
                    proxy_set_header   X-Real-IP        $remote_addr;
                    proxy_set_header   X-Forwarded-For  $proxy_add_x_forwarded_for;

                    client_max_body_size       10m;
                    client_body_buffer_size    128k;

                    proxy_connect_timeout      90;
                    proxy_send_timeout         90;
                    proxy_read_timeout         90;

                    proxy_buffer_size          4k;
                    proxy_buffers              4 32k;
                    proxy_busy_buffers_size    64k;  
                    proxy_temp_file_write_size 64k;  
                }                                    

                # Static files location
                                      
            }                          


Конфига внутреннего сервера nginx  с fast-cgi

user  nobody;
worker_processes  16;

#error_log  logs/error.log;
#error_log  logs/error.log  notice;
#error_log  logs/error.log  info;  

#pid        logs/nginx.pid;


events {
    worker_connections  1024;
}                            


http {
    include       mime.types;
    default_type  application/octet-stream;

    #log_format  main  '$remote_addr - $remote_user [$time_local] $request '
    #                  '"$status" $body_bytes_sent "$http_referer" '        
    #                  '"$http_user_agent" "$http_x_forwarded_for"';        

    #access_log  logs/access.log  main;

    sendfile        on;
    #tcp_nopush     on;
    client_max_body_size 100m;
    #keepalive_timeout  0;    
    keepalive_timeout  65;    

    gzip  on;

    server {
        listen       80;
        server_name  shop.sunrise-ufa.ru;

        #charset koi8-r;

        #access_log  logs/host.access.log  main;


#       location /phpMyAdmin {
#       root /usr/share/;    
#       index index.php;      
#       }                    
                              
        location / {          
            root   /var/www/html;
            index  index.php;    
        }                        

        #error_page  404              /404.html;

        # redirect server error pages to the static page /50x.html
        #                                                        
        error_page   500 502 503 504  /50x.html;                  
        location = /50x.html {                                    
            root   html;                                          
        }                                                        

        # proxy the PHP scripts to Apache listening on 127.0.0.1:80
        #                                                          
        #location ~ \.php$ {                                      
        #    proxy_pass   http://127.0.0.1;       &...
                                                                  
        #}                                                        

        # pass the PHP scripts to FastCGI server listening on 127.0.0.1:9000
        #                                                                  
        location ~ \.php$ {                                                
            fastcgi_pass   127.0.0.1:9000;                                  
#            fastcgi_pass   unix:/var/run/php/fcgi;                        
            fastcgi_index  index.php;                                      
            fastcgi_param  SCRIPT_FILENAME  /var/www/html$fastcgi_script_name;
            fastcgi_param  QUERY_STRING     $query_string;                    
            fastcgi_param  REQUEST_METHOD   $request_method;                  
            fastcgi_param  CONTENT_TYPE     $content_type;                    
            fastcgi_param  CONTENT_LENGTH   $content_length;                  
            include        fastcgi_params;                                    
                                                                              
        }                                                                    

        # deny access to .htaccess files, if Apache's document root
        # concurs with nginx's one                                
        #                                                          
        #location ~ /\.ht {                                        
        #    deny  all;                                            
        #}                                                        


    }

На сервере крутится Joomla 1.5.7 c virtuemart'ом.

Значит суть проблемы в следующем, когда открываеш сайт с помощью firefox или opera и ie6  все нормально, при открытии сайта IE7  - он грузит половину контента, после чего выдает предупреждение что сайт не может быть отображени выводит страницу с разрешением проблем.

Высказать мнение | Ответить | Правка | Cообщить модератору

 Оглавление

Сообщения по теме [Сортировка по времени | RSS]


1. "кеширующий nginx + внутренний nginx+fast-cgi проблема с IE7 "  
Сообщение от Drock email(ok) on 10-Окт-08, 08:45 
PS // кеширование средствами joomla отключена
Высказать мнение | Ответить | Правка | Наверх | Cообщить модератору

2. "кеширующий nginx + внутренний nginx+fast-cgi проблема с IE7 "  
Сообщение от Vaso_Petrovich on 10-Окт-08, 10:02 
>PS // кеширование средствами joomla отключена

сдается мне что ослик тут не причем, сделай простую страницу и прогрузи в осклике, если все будет нормально, то ищи что у тебя на той странице не грузится... ну типа коунтер или погода, либо еще левотина какая-нибудь...

Высказать мнение | Ответить | Правка | Наверх | Cообщить модератору

3. "кеширующий nginx + внутренний nginx+fast-cgi проблема с IE7 "  
Сообщение от Drock (ok) on 12-Окт-08, 18:34 
и ещё вопрос, внутренний сервер определяет и пишет в логи что к нему обращается только внешний сервер, т.е в лог попадает ip кеширующего сервера

Высказать мнение | Ответить | Правка | Наверх | Cообщить модератору

Архив | Удалить

Индекс форумов | Темы | Пред. тема | След. тема
Оцените тред (1=ужас, 5=супер)? [ 1 | 2 | 3 | 4 | 5 ] [Рекомендовать для помещения в FAQ]




Партнёры:
PostgresPro
Inferno Solutions
Hosting by Hoster.ru
Хостинг:

Закладки на сайте
Проследить за страницей
Created 1996-2024 by Maxim Chirkov
Добавить, Поддержать, Вебмастеру